Physical geography

Physical geography is a subfield of geography that focuses on the study of Earth’s natural features and processes. It examines the physical characteristics of the Earth’s surface and how they interact with both human and natural activities. This branch of geography encompasses a wide range of topics and disciplines, providing a holistic understanding of the Earth’s physical environment.

Key elements of physical geography include:

  1. Landforms and Topography: Physical geography investigates the various landforms that make up the Earth’s surface, such as mountains, valleys, plains, plateaus, and deserts. It also explores the processes that shape these features, including erosion, weathering, and tectonic activity.
  2. Climate and Weather: The study of climate and weather patterns falls under physical geography. This involves understanding atmospheric processes, temperature variations, precipitation, wind patterns, and climatic zones. Climatology is a specialized sub-discipline that focuses specifically on climate.
  3. Biogeography: Biogeography examines the distribution of plant and animal species across the planet. It explores the factors influencing the geographic patterns of biodiversity, such as climate, topography, and human activities.
  4. Hydrology: Hydrology is the study of water in all its forms, including rivers, lakes, oceans, groundwater, and atmospheric water. Physical geographers analyze the movement of water through the hydrological cycle, including processes like evaporation, condensation, precipitation, and runoff.
  5. Soils and Pedology: The composition, formation, and classification of soils are essential components of physical geography. Pedology, a sub-discipline, specifically focuses on the study of soils, including their properties and distribution.
  6. Natural Hazards: Physical geography examines natural hazards such as earthquakes, volcanic eruptions, hurricanes, floods, and landslides. Understanding the causes and consequences of these events is crucial for assessing and managing the associated risks.
  7. Ecosystems and Ecology: Physical geography explores ecosystems and their interactions with the physical environment. It considers the relationships between living organisms, their habitats, and the surrounding landscapes.
  8. Remote Sensing and GIS: Modern techniques, such as remote sensing and Geographic Information Systems (GIS), play a significant role in physical geography. These technologies allow geographers to collect, analyze, and visualize spatial data, enhancing our understanding of Earth’s physical processes.
